The Senior Data Scientist plays a pivotal role in designing, developing, and operationalizing advanced risk models that leverage Nearmap’s AI data and third-party sources to deliver actionable insurance risk insights.
This role bridges cutting-edge technical model development with actuarial applications, helping insurance companies integrate Nearmap’s AI-driven intelligence into pricing, underwriting, modeling, and regulatory workflows.
As a senior member of the Insurance AI team, you will:
- Lead modeling initiatives from conception through deployment.
- Serve as a trusted technical and domain expert for both internal teams and external clients.
- Drive innovation in how Nearmap’s data is applied within insurance products and workflows.
- Provide strategic actuarial and statistical guidance to ensure models meet both technical rigor and practical business needs.
This role requires the ability to seamlessly transition between in-depth technical work, high-level solution design, and client-facing consulting with senior insurance stakeholders. As such, deep experience working as a data scientist or actuary training and evaluating models in the property casualty (P&C) insurance space is critical.
Key Responsibilities
- Technical Leadership in Model Development
- Lead the design, development, and refinement of insurance risk models using Nearmap AI data and other sources.
- Conduct exploratory data analysis, advanced feature engineering, model selection, training, validation, and performance optimization.
- Guide the integration of geospatial, property, and external datasets into scalable, production-ready solutions.
- Actuarial & Regulatory Expertise
- Serve as a senior technical liaison to actuarial, data science, and pricing teams at insurance companies, ensuring successful adoption of Nearmap data in their workflows.
- Advise on and prepare regulatory filing materials, respond to objections, and ensure models meet compliance standards for property/casualty insurance.
- Strategic Data Asset Development
- Spearhead efforts to grow and optimize Nearmap’s proprietary policy and loss database for product and modeling innovation.
- Client Engagement & Solution Integration
- Lead high-impact retro tests, validation studies, and custom analyses for top-tier insurance clients.
- Translate complex technical results into strategic business recommendations for senior decision-makers.
- Thought Leadership & Mentorship
- Mentor junior team members on best practices in modeling, data analysis, and insurance-specific applications.
Key Requirements
- 5+ years of practical experience in property/casualty insurance in a data science or actuarial role.
- Proven leadership in complex modeling projects from ideation through deployment.
- Experience advising senior insurance stakeholders and influencing strategic decision-making.
Required:
- Domain Knowledge: Deep expertise in property/casualty insurance pricing, rating, and regulatory requirements.
- Data Science: Advanced capability in feature engineering, model validation, uncertainty quantification, and statistical testing.
- Programming: Expert in Python (NumPy, Pandas, Scikit-learn, Matplotlib) and git-based workflows.
- Communication: Exceptional ability to translate technical findings into actionable business insights for executive-level audiences.
- Data/ML Engineering: Familiarity with scalable pipelines, MLOps practices, and production deployments
Highly Desirable:
- Experience with geospatial and imagery data (GeoPandas or similar).
- Prior experience integrating AI-derived datasets into insurer pricing and underwriting workflows.
